Concrete sawing services involve the use of specialized equipment to cut through concrete surfaces with precision. These services are often utilized to create openings, such as doorways, windows, or utility access points, or to make modifications to existing concrete structures. The process typically involves diamond-tipped blades that can cut through various thicknesses of concrete, asphalt, or other hard materials efficiently and accurately. This method allows for controlled cuts that minimize damage to surrounding areas, making it suitable for projects requiring precise dimensions and clean results.

One of the primary issues concrete sawing helps address is the need for structural modifications or repairs. Whether installing new plumbing, electrical conduits, or HVAC systems, creating openings in existing concrete slabs or walls is often necessary. Additionally, concrete sawing is used for demolition purposes, such as removing sections of a slab or wall without affecting the integrity of the remaining structure. This service is also valuable for preparing surfaces for overlays or resurfacing, ensuring that the surface is properly cut and ready for subsequent work.

Various types of properties utilize concrete sawing services, including comm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and residential properties. Commercial sites often require concrete cutting for installing large-scale infrastructure or performing renovations that involve cutting through parking lots, sidewalks, or foundation walls. Industrial properties may need precise cuts for creating access points or removing damaged sections of concrete. Residential properties also benefit from these services when making modifications to driveways, patios, or basement floors, especially in situations where minimal disturbance to the surrounding area is desired.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Sawing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Franksville,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Perimeter Cutting - The cost for perimeter concrete sawing typically ranges from $2 to $4 per linear foot. For example, cutting a 50-foot perimeter may cost between $100 and $200 depending on complexity and location.

Wall and Floor Cuts - Prices for wall or floor cuts usually fall between $3 and $6 per square foot. A 200-square-foot floor cut might therefore range from $600 to $1,200, varying with material and accessibility.

Core Drilling - Core drilling services are often billed at approximately $10 to $15 per inch of diameter. Drilling a 6-inch hole could cost between $60 and $90, depending on site conditions.

Equipment Rental Fees - Rental costs for concrete sawing equipment generally range from $50 to $150 per day. Longer rental periods or specialized machinery may incur higher charges, varying by local provid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ete sawing services are available? Local service providers offer various concrete sawing options including flat sawing, wall sawing, and core drilling to meet different project needs.

How do I know if concrete sawing is necessary for my project? A professional contractor can assess your project requirements and determine if concrete sawing is needed for demolition, renovation, or new construction.

What equipment is used for concrete sawing? Contractors typically utilize specialized saws such as walk-behind saws, wall saws, and core drills equipped with diamond blades for efficient cutting.
